Wander through the quaint village of Near Sawrey, where Beatrix Potter found inspiration for her timeless tales. The tour includes a visit to Hill Top, Potter’s former home, where the stories of Peter Rabbit and friends come to life. As you explore the charming cottage and its gardens, you’ll feel as though you’ve stepped into the pages of her books. The tour also includes stops at Wray Castle and the Beatrix Potter Gallery, offering a comprehensive look at the life and legacy of this literary icon.

Cultural Immersion: Museums and More

When the rain persists, Cumbria’s museums offer a warm and welcoming escape. The region is home to a variety of family-friendly museums that cater to curious minds of all ages. The Tullie House Museum and Art Gallery in Carlisle is a must-visit, with its engaging exhibits on local history, art, and natural sciences. Children will delight in the interactive displays, while adults can appreciate the rich cultural heritage of the area.

For a more hands-on experience, consider visiting the Rheged Centre, a unique venue that combines art, culture, and shopping under one roof. With its cinema, art gallery, and craft workshops, the Rheged Centre offers a diverse range of activities to suit every interest. Whether you’re exploring the latest art exhibition or participating in a pottery class, the centre provides a creative outlet for the whole family.
